Task Risk Comparison
Tasks sorted by AI automation risk — higher means more automatable
Structural Iron and Steel Workers
2 of 15 at risk71%Read specifications or blueprints to determine the locations, quantities, or sizes of materials required.
70%Verify vertical and horizontal alignment of structural steel members, using plumb bobs, laser equipment, transits, or levels.
13%Cut, bend, or weld steel pieces, using metal shears, torches, or welding equipment.
11%Assemble or inspect hoisting equipment or rigging, such as cables, pulleys, or hooks, to move heavy equipment or materials.
11%Lift steel beams, girders, or columns using cranes or forklifts, or by signaling hoisting equipment operators to lift or position structural steel members.
Helpers--Carpenters
5 of 15 at risk63%Hold plumb bobs, sighting rods, or other equipment to aid in establishing reference points and lines.
57%Cut timbers, lumber, or paneling to specified dimensions.
57%Smooth or sand surfaces to remove ridges, tool marks, glue, or caulking.
53%Glue and clamp edges or joints of assembled parts.
51%Perform tie spacing layout and measure, mark, drill or cut.
